Got this Panasonic TH-P50G10A 7 blinks.
Typically you'd be expecting SC board and I was not disappointed there.
But this is not your typical blown SC. Essentially it's not shorted or none of the IGBTs are.
I found the VSCN voltage was a bit weird, so I did what i hate doing and disabled the SOS7 cct.
Turn it on, no bangs , no smoke , perfect picture.
Now take another reading Vscn to chassis is reading 14-15V, -40V is expected and to VAD it's about 200V expected 145V. So a difference of 55V.
can't work it out , have probed and swapped over almost the entire Vscn gen cct.
